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2266 027337606 2447
689641 496434539
689641 496434539
45531426 7955699 6181287
All about undefined
Interested in learning more?
689641 496434539
45531426 7955699 6181287
See more
56315068625 40512001817 8199
63 0522 9702 3461745
See more
798287504 23529 655789
2113 730 363131498
See more